‘Shiatsu is a touch based therapy that applies pressure to areas of the surface of the body for the purpose of correcting imbalances, and maintaining and promoting health’
Shiatsu Regulatory Group UK 2007
About Shiatsu
The definition of Shiatsu at the top of each page represents a minimal definition to which all member organisations can subscribe, and which does not exclude any of them. However, each organisation will expand on this definition to provide more information on its own beliefs, practices, and extension of this definition.
